assicurazione mostre, or exhibition insurance, is a type of insurance specifically designed to protect the valuable artwork and artifacts on display at exhibitions and art shows. These events often showcase priceless pieces of art that are loaned from museums, galleries, and private collections, making them vulnerable to damage, theft, or other unforeseen risks. assicurazione mostre provides coverage for such risks, giving peace of mind to organizers, lenders, and exhibitors.
One of the key benefits of assicurazione mostre is that it can help mitigate financial losses in the event of accidents or incidents that result in damage to the artwork. This can include accidents such as fire, flooding, or structural collapses, as well as theft or vandalism. Given the high value and irreplaceable nature of many of the pieces on display at exhibitions, the financial consequences of such events can be devastating. assicurazione mostre helps to offset these risks and provide a safety net for all parties involved.
Furthermore, assicurazione mostre can also help protect against legal liabilities that may arise from accidents or incidents at exhibitions. For example, if a visitor is injured on the premises or if property belonging to a third party is damaged during the event, the organizers may be held liable for the damages. Assicurazione mostre can provide coverage for legal fees, settlements, and other costs associated with such liabilities, helping to protect the financial interests of the organizers and exhibitors.
When it comes to choosing assicurazione mostre, there are several factors to consider. The first is the value of the artwork on display. Different policies will have different coverage limits and premiums depending on the total value of the items being insured. It is crucial to accurately assess the value of the artwork and obtain coverage that adequately protects against potential losses.
Additionally, the specific risks that need to be covered should be taken into account when selecting assicurazione mostre. For example, exhibitions held in historic buildings or outdoor venues may face different risks than those held in modern, climate-controlled galleries. It is important to evaluate the unique risks associated with each exhibition and ensure that the insurance policy provides coverage for these specific risks.
Another important consideration when obtaining assicurazione mostre is the reputation and financial stability of the insurance provider. It is essential to work with a reputable insurer that has experience in insuring art exhibitions and has the financial resources to pay out claims in the event of an incident. Checking the insurer’s track record, customer reviews, and financial ratings can help ensure that the policyholder is working with a reliable partner.
In addition to providing financial protection, assicurazione mostre can also offer other benefits to the policyholder. For example, some policies may include coverage for restoration and conservation costs in the event that the artwork is damaged. This can help ensure that damaged pieces are properly repaired and restored to their original condition, preserving their value and integrity.
